On average across the year,
yes, Kuwait is hotter than
Lauderhill, Florida
.
Kuwait has an average temperature of 29°C/84°F and Lauderhill, Florida has an average temperature of 25°C/77°F.
Kuwait's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 48°C/118°F, which is hotter than Lauderhill, Florida's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F).
On average across the year, no, Kuwait is not colder than Lauderhill, Florida . Kuwait has an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F and Lauderhill, Florida has an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F.
On average across the year,
no, Kuwait has less rain than
Lauderhill, Florida. Kuwait has an average annual rainfall of 62mm and Lauderhill, Florida has an average annual rainfall of 1663mm.
Kuwait's wettest month is November, with an average monthly rainfall of 20mm, which is drier than Lauderhill, Florida's wettest month (September, with an average monthly rainfall of 217mm).
